Depends how the firms define the roles.

At my firm a legal assistant pretty much does admin only, I’m lucky that I get to do paralegal work (without the job title and pay promotion because my current firm are tight…).

If you want legal experience though, paralegal would likely be better (again depending on how firm defines the roles). Also it depends on your financial status and security whether you can afford to take lower pay in exchange for legal experience.
